About I.H. Hall
I.H. Hall is a scholar working on Molecular Biology, Organic Chemistry, Oncology, Cancer Research and Pharmacology, having authored 83 papers that have together received 1.6k indexed citations. Recurring topics across this work include Biochemical and Molecular Research (14 papers), Cancer therapeutics and mechanisms (12 papers), Sesquiterpenes and Asteraceae Studies (10 papers), Boron Compounds in Chemistry (8 papers), Metabolism and Genetic Disorders (7 papers), HIV/AIDS drug development and treatment (7 papers), Mitochondrial Function and Pathology (7 papers) and Adipose Tissue and Metabolism (6 papers). The work is most often cited by research in Cancer Research (295 citations), Organic Chemistry (495 citations), Toxicology (44 citations), Molecular Biology (760 citations) and Biochemistry (76 citations). I.H. Hall has collaborated with scholars based in United States, Serbia and United Kingdom. Frequent co-authors include K.H. Lee, Bernard F. Spielvogel, C.O. Starnes, Thomas K. Waddell, Mia Miller, Yoichi Sumida, Rong-Yang Wu, D.X. West, Anup Sood and George H. Cocolas. Their work appears in journals such as Journal of Pharmaceutical Sciences, Experimental Biology and Medicine, Journal of Medicinal Chemistry, Applied Organometallic Chemistry and Anti-Cancer Drugs.
